KINROSS won this in 2022 and ran a cracker last year so, having confirmed himself as good as ever at Doncaster last time, he just about edges the vote over Ramatuelle, who has been saved for this on the back of an excellent third in the Coronation Stakes at Royal Ascot. Tribalist is another obvious player if he can secure the early lead.
